Output 0c04dc13d8b3301d49d21a927e5fa2298e22fb4a30d83a05d79b99478a357722:14

value
73650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 444ce920ef690ae0ded717d1b00c9390bd983cd9 OP_EQUALVERIFY OP_CHECKSIG
address
17E95tfQKnTpnHpxR72fQvR67MaUx4AqdA
transaction
0c04dc13d8b3301d49d21a927e5fa2298e22fb4a30d83a05d79b99478a357722
confirmations
558585
spent
true